Unsafe Building Conditions to Look Out For

Exterior

  • Downed power lines and trees
  • Chemical contamination (fuel oil, asbestos, toxic gas)
  • Displaced animals, rodents, insects
  • Sewage
  • Unstable ground
  • Flooding

Interior: building hazards

  • Asbestos
  • Lead paint
  • PCBs
  • Toxic metals (chromium and lead)
  • Fuel oil
  • Electrical system damage (sparks, frayed wires)
  • Gas leaks or explosion
  • Flooding
  • Unstable floors
  • Fixtures/objects that may fall

Interior: general

  • moldhoriz-100 Smoldering or new fire
  • Contaminated water
  • Mold
  • Smoke and/or soot (may contain arsenic)
  • Mud (slippery and contaminated)
  • Pests, dead and alive
  • Garbage and raw sewage

 

Interior: art material hazards

  • brokenglass-100 Lead
  • Toxic pigments
  • Spilled solvents
  • Acetylene tanks
  • Broken glass and pottery
  • Sharp tools
